Picking the ideal baby cot includes thinking about different features that might affect your baby's safety and convenience. Here's a list of crucial components to evaluate:
Safety Standards: Ensure that the cot fulfills the required safety requirements in your nation. Try to find accreditations from acknowledged organizations.
Material: Choose a cot made from resilient and non-toxic products. Solid wood is often chosen over particle board due to its toughness.
Adjustable Mattress Height: Many cots provide adjustable bed mattress heights. This permits simpler gain access to when positioning your baby in the cot and assists avoid injuries as the child grows.
Style: While visual appeal is essential, focus on performance. Some cots come with extra features such as storage drawers and convertibility options.
Mobility: If you require mobility, consider a cot with wheels or one that is lightweight for simple motion around your house.
Mattress Quality: Invest in an excellent quality bed mattress that fits comfortably into the cot and is firm enough to support your newborn's establishing spinal column.
Establishing the Baby Cot
When you have selected the best cot Newborn cot for your newborn, it's essential to set it up correctly for maximum safety and convenience. Here are some important ideas:
Location: Place the cot in a safe location far from windows, curtains, and cords that could posture a strangulation hazard.
Bedding: Use a fitted sheet on the mattress and prevent heavy blankets, pillows, or toys that can increase the danger of Sudden Infant Death Syndrome (SIDS).
Ventilation: Ensure the cot has necessary airflow, particularly if it is placed in an enclosed space.
Inspect Stability: Regularly examine that the cot stays stable and all screws and joints are tight.
Display Temperature: Keep the space at a comfortable temperature, as getting too hot can be a danger element for SIDS.

2. What safety functions should I try to find in a baby cot?
Look for features such as adjustable mattress heights, no sharp edges, a stable frame, and slats that disappear than 2.375 inches apart to avoid your baby from getting trapped.
